Check the Walther forum. The CCP appears to be a rather problematic firearm. I believe it's made by Umarex in their Airgun factory in Arnsberg, as opposed to the PPS which is made by Walther in Ulm.
I have a PPS Classic and a PPS M2. Both are really excellent, well-made pistols, ideally-suited for concealed carry. I also have a couple of PPQs...likewise excellent pistol.

The CCP is not made by Walther, in the same way that the Mosquito is not made by Sig. Quality wise, there is no comparison between the PPS and CCP.
